Od izrazite je važnosti procjena zdravstvenog stanja konja od strane jahača tijekom cijelog natjecanja.Exhausted horse syndrome is a multi- systemic disorder in sport horses subjected to long term physical activity, especially during hot weather conditions. Increased physical activity can lead to dehydration, hypovolemia, electrolyte loss, acid-base imbalance, depletion of energy reserves and hyperthermia. The clinical presentation depends on the severity and speed of onset of fatigue, and on the individual tolerance of the horse to exercise intensity. Diagnosis is based on the anamnesis, clinical signs and laboratory findings. In severe cases, the diagnosis is easily established, whilst early recognition in mild cases is difficult due to the subtlety of clinical signs and lack of objective clinical and diagnostic criteria. The treatment goal is comprised of three main approaches: decreasing body temperature, replacing fluids and electrolytes, and restoring circulating blood volume. Prognosis is good in mild cases, while in severe cases, presentation is questionable due to possible complications, with the possibility of a lethal outcome. Prevention of exhausted horse syndrome is possible by choosing the appropriate horse breed for the sport, maintaining horse health through regular veterinary inspection, gradually increasing training intensity, and avoiding demanding conditioning training lasting several days in a row. The riderā€™s evaluation of horse health through the competition is of great importance

S druge strane, kod pasa od kojih očekujemo dugotrajan rad umjerenog do visokog intenziteta, udio ugljikohidrata u obroku može biti zastupljen u znatno nižem postotku, dok je razinu energije iz bjelančevina i masti potrebno prilagoditi vrsti rada.In sporting and working dogs, exercise induces various physiological responses, depending on the exercise type and intensity. Physical activity ranges from short duration, high intensity activity such as in Greyhound races, to long duration, low intensity activity in sled dog races. In search and rescue, and hunting dogs, apart from obedience and scent detection, a many hours of fieldwork is expected, which combines intervals of high and low activity for a prolonged period. Nutrition of sporting and working dogs should be appropriate for the training and specific performance required, with the goal of preparing the organism for the high demands of activity, and also to prevent injuries related to insufficient nutrient intake, which may affect speed, strength and endurance. For that reason, the recommended portions and sources of specific macronutrients in the diet should be correlated with the type, intensity and duration of activity. In dogs which are expected to perform a short duration, high intensity activity (racing hounds), the daily ration should consist of easily digestible carbohydrates at the level of 50 ā€“ 60% metabolic energy, whilst the percentage of fat and protein should be lower. On the other hand, for dogs that are expected to perform a long duration, medium to high intensity activity, the carbohydrate portion may be lower, with fat and protein energy levels adjusted according to the specific activity

Cilj je ovoga preglednog rada prikazati specifičnosti hernijacije intervertebralnog diska te mogućnosti dijagnostike slikovnim metodama raspoloživima u svakodnevnoj veterinarskoj praksi.Intervertebral disc herniation is a common disorder of the intervertebral disc. There are many causes of this condition: disc degeneration, trauma, infection, or anatomical/developmental abnormalities. In the diagnosis of herniation, various methods of diagnostic imaging can be applied, such as: survey radiography, myelography, computed tomography or magnetic resonance imaging. According to the literature, the most reliable method has proven to be magnetic resonance imaging, which allows for a sound diagnosis and localization in 100% of cases, while the success rates of detection for other methods are lower. It should be noted that the use of a particular imaging method in the localization and lateralization of the herniation site of the intervertebral disc in everyday practice is usually guided by the financial capacities of the owner, the availability of a particular method, and the urgency of the procedure. Consequently, the test results vary and thus the accuracy of the herniation localization. The aim of this review article is to show the specifics of intervertebral disc herniation and the methods for the most accurate diagnosis using imaging methods available in everyday veterinary practice

Biljezi miÅ”ićnog oÅ”tećenja ukazuju da aktivnost duljeg trajanja i različitog intenziteta rezultira opsežnim fizioloÅ”kim procesima i viÅ”im energetskim potrebama kod radnih potražnih pasa.The aim of the study was to evaluate the changes in serum biochemistry values in Croatian Mountain Rescue Service dogs included in two different feeding regimes during stimulated fieldwork. There were 12 healthy dogs (age 3.57Ā±1.81) included in the study, divided into two groups: pressed dog food (PRESS group) and raw meat-based diet (BARF group). The diets differed in macronutrients level: on a dry matter basis BARF diet consisted of protein, fat, and carbohydrate in the following proportions: 45.2:32.2:5.5 and kibble diet 27.5:18.7:42.8. During the period of 4 months, blood samples were obtained two times per month: baseline sample in the morning before feeding and the second one immediately after the fieldwork. Results were compared between and within the two groups had shown that pre and post-exercise glucose level was not affected by the type of diet and remained within the reference range. Post-exercise serum levels of lactate within the groups did not differ significantly. Nevertheless, the basal level of lactate was significantly lower in BARF versus PRESS group. The transitory rise in urea and creatinine levels post exercise as well as lower level of inorganic phosphorus was noted in the BARF group, whereas higher basal levels of creatinine and higher post workout levels of inorganic phosphorus were measured in PRESS group. Results within both groups showed higher activity of CK, LDH and AST in both grups post-exercise, as well as lower levels of total cholesterol and Mg. Post-exercise level of TAG was higher in BARF group in comparison to PRESS group. Conducted research reflects different metabolic response to feeding regimes with different macronutrient composition, as well as differences in biochemical parameters as response to processing procedure, especially visible through inorganic phosphate and creatinine level. Stabile glucose level after strenuous fieldwork would indicate excessive metabolic adaptations to the main source of energy provided through observed feeding regimes. An increased ability to utilize fat should be considered an advantage in a dog subjected to prolonged fieldwork in which fatty acid oxidation is used as main energy source. Muscle damage indicators suggest that long period of different intensity level workload in search and rescue dogs result in various physiological processes as well as overall increased muscle activity demands

Fizikalna terapija u kombinaciji s adekvatnim kućnim rehabilitacijskim programom može rezultirati skraćenim razdobljem oporavka za pacijente s AIP-om.Acute idiopathic polyradiculoneuritis (AIP) is an acquired peripheral neuropathy that primarily affects the ventral spinal nerve roots and peripheral nerves. The disease is very similar to Guillan BarrĆ© syndrome in humans. There is no age, breed, or sex predilection associated with the development of AIP. No proven specific treatment exists. Recovery occurs within 2 - 6 months. Physical therapy and nursing care are recommended as supportive treatment. Two female mix breed dogs, aged 6 and 10 years, were admitted to the physical therapy unit with signs of acute flaccid non-ambulatory tetraparesis/tetraplegia in lateral recumbency, unable to assume the sternal position unassisted as a consequence of generalised lower motor neuron signs. Reduced to absent muscle tone was present in all limbs. A tentative diagnosis of AIP was made based on history, clinical presentation, neurologic examination, diagnostic imaging and routine laboratory tests. The rehabilitation programme included massage, joint passive range of motion (PROM) as an important part of the home programme, electrotherapy, hydrotherapy and proprioceptive exercises. After two weeks, dogs were able to maintain a sternal position without support, and showed voluntary movement of the hind limbs. Assistive standing and voluntary movements of all limbs were present by the end of third week in one patient, and fifth week in the other. At that point, underwater treadmill sessions and active exercises were introduced. Dogs were ambulating without assistance after 25 days in one patient and after 50 days in other. Physical therapy combined with a proper home rehabilitation programme can result in a positive functional outcome in a shorter period of time in dogs with AIP
